Transaction 518358ceebcfcfd43a8d7c07781f84e39fb60de3fa4a731cd1d5f62831c599d8

1 Input
2 Outputs
  • 518358ceebcfcfd43a8d7c07781f84e39fb60de3fa4a731cd1d5f62831c599d8:0
  • value  1350144
    address  3FTX3Wv5ApJTyKkevH8iTTNQvvmhv6AYEr
  • 518358ceebcfcfd43a8d7c07781f84e39fb60de3fa4a731cd1d5f62831c599d8:1
  • value  89272
    address  1NmdKSYzpoRnjqnwDr673iQbFRHcAA53nQ